Bio:

Nan Janecke works as Coordinator of the Academically Talented Youth Program at Western Michigan University. A graduate of the University of Michigan with a bachelor’s degree in English, she also has her master’s in School Counseling. An advocate for gifted education for many years, Nan is past president of the Michigan Association for Gifted Children after serving as Communications Officer and editor of MAGC’s newsletter for more than a decade. She is also a founding member and president of Partners in Learning for Unlimited Success of Southwest Michigan, a regional support and advocacy group for families of gifted children. Nan is a frequent speaker at both MAGC and NAGC conferences, specializing in topics related to social/emotional issues, parenting, and gifted students in middle school.
